If your toothache isn’t caused by a serious underlying issue or you are waiting for an upcoming dental appointment, you can get toothache relief with over-the-counter … See more WebDec 3, 2024 · The reason is simple – due to the tooth’s anatomy and the infection’s nature, antibiotics are almost entirely ineffective. Typically, antibiotics travel through the bloodstream to reach infected areas of the body. However, dental infection often completely destroys the blood vessels that supply the inside of the tooth. in a high pressure system air
